Rhode Island House Bill H6133

Introduced
3/26/25  
CRIMINAL PROCEDURE -- INDICTMENTS, INFORMATIONS AND COMPLAINTS - Provides that the statute of limitations for second-degree sexual assault shall be 10 years from the date of the offense, or, in the case of a victim who is under the age of 18, ten years from the victim’s eighteenth birthday, whichever is later.

Rhode Island Senate Bill S0903

Introduced
3/27/25  
COMMERCIAL LAW -- GENERAL REGULATORY PROVISIONS -- AGE-APPROPRIATE DESIGN CODE - Requires that any covered entity that develops/provides online services, products, or features that children are reasonably likely to access shall consider the best interest of children when designing/developing such online service, product, or feature.

Rhode Island Senate Bill S0884

Introduced
3/27/25  
Refer
3/27/25  
Report Pass
6/2/25  
Engrossed
6/4/25  
Enrolled
6/20/25  
COMMERCIAL LAW -- GENERAL REGULATORY PROVISIONS -- RIGHT TO CONSUMER ACCESS TO POWERED WHEELCHAIR REPAIRS - Provides that original power wheelchair equipment manufacturers would be required to provide to independent service providers repair information and tools to maintain and repair original power wheelchair equipment.

Rhode Island Senate Bill S0908

Introduced
3/27/25  
Refer
3/27/25  
Report Pass
5/27/25  
DELINQUENT AND DEPENDENT CHILDREN -- PROCEEDINGS IN FAMILY COURT - Removes the mandatory certification for an individual 16 years or older who was found delinquent for having committed 2 offenses after the age of 16 which would render the person subject to an indictment if the person was an adult.

Rhode Island House Bill H6055

Introduced
3/12/25  
COMMERCIAL LAW -- GENERAL REGULATORY PROVISIONS -- INTEREST AND USURY - Allows RI to opt out of the provisions of DIDMCA exempting out of state lenders from interest rate limits which apply to RI lenders. Prevents evasion of statutory interest rate limits and lending rules for loans made in RI.
